Military Rescues Abducted Priest In Marawi

September 18 2017

Philippines

The Philippine military has rescued a Catholic priest who was kidnapped almost four months ago by Islamic State-linked militants when they occupied Marawi in the southern part of the country, reports Agence France-Presse.

Father Teresito Suganob was freed late Saturday when the military reportedly captured the command center of the remaining militants in Marawi.

Suganob was kidnapped in May along with 13 parishioners during the first day of fighting in Marawi.
